Middlesbrough Tees Pride is a 10 km Road Race and a 3 km Fun Run. It is organised by Middlesbrough Council who apply Road Closure Acts for the duration of the event. It is believed that this is the largest 10 km event in the north of England. Competitors run, walk, hobble and race wheelchairs over the 10 km (6.2 mile) route on public roads. In 2007, the 10 km Road Race had 2,400 runners and the 3 km Fun Run had 600 runners. Cleveland RAYNET Group, assisted by other RAYNET groups, provide comms. to help the safe administration of the event. Middlesbrough Council MTP Website
